Share of urban population who live in the largest city in Cyprus
Cyprus: Share of urban population who live in the largest city was 32.2% in 2020. ▲ Rising
Share of urban population who live in the largest city in Cyprus, 1950–2020
Source: European Commission, Joint Research Centre (JRC) (2025) – with minor processing by Our World in Data. Measured in %.
Analysis
Cyprus recorded 32.2% for share of urban population who live in the largest city in 2020.
The figure is up 6.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of urban population who live in the largest city in Cyprus peaked at 36.1% in 1985 and was at its lowest, 25.1%, in 1950.
That places Cyprus 62nd out of 179 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 15 years of available data.

About this data
Percentage of the urban population living in the country's largest city (by population). City boundaries are defined using a consistent global approach based on satellite imagery and population data.
